| Title: | Journal of Philology. Ural-Altaic studies |
| Publisher: | Tezaurus |
| Description: | This publication is unique for several reasons: 1) The journal is bilingual; all papers are published in both Russian and English language. 2) For the first time, roughly equal number of works by authors from Russian provinces and by foreign authors are published in a journal on Uralic and Altaic languages. 3) Publication of works is always free for the authors; the only criterion for publication is expert evaluation of the scientific value of the paper. 4) All papers are evaluated by two (three or more in controversial cases) independent reviewers. They evaluate papers on the following criteria: a) scientific novelty, b) knowledge of the literature on the question, c) scientific value, d) quality of presentation Accepted are only works with two highest or one highest and one medium rating. Thus, only papers with very high scientific level are published. The first issue of the journal is distributed free of charge. Other issues will be available only by subscription. |
